|
9 | 9 | core.Field('clsID', 'U1'), |
10 | 10 | core.Field('msgID', 'U1'), |
11 | 11 | ]), |
12 | | - core.Message(0x00, 'NAK', [ |
| 12 | + core.Message(0x01, 'NAK', [ |
13 | 13 | core.Field('clsID', 'U1'), |
14 | 14 | core.Field('msgID', 'U1'), |
15 | 15 | ]) |
|
181 | 181 | core.BitField('flags', 'X1', [ |
182 | 182 | core.Flag('gnssFixOK', 0, 1), |
183 | 183 | core.Flag('diffSoln', 1, 2), |
184 | | - core.Flag('psmState', 2, 5), |
185 | | - core.Flag('headVehValid', 5, 6), |
| 184 | + core.Flag('headVehValid', 2, 5), |
186 | 185 | core.Flag('carrSoln', 6, 8), |
187 | 186 | ]), |
188 | 187 | core.BitField('flags2', 'X1', [ |
|
218 | 217 | core.Field('relPosN', 'I4'), |
219 | 218 | core.Field('relPosE', 'I4'), |
220 | 219 | core.Field('relPosD', 'I4'), |
221 | | - core.Field('relPosLength', 'I4'), |
222 | | - core.Field('relPosHeading', 'I4'), |
223 | | - core.PadByte(repeat=3), |
224 | 220 | core.Field('relPosHPN', 'I1'), |
225 | 221 | core.Field('relPosHPE', 'I1'), |
226 | 222 | core.Field('relPosHPD', 'I1'), |
227 | | - core.Field('relPosHPLength', 'I1'), |
| 223 | + core.PadByte(), |
228 | 224 | core.Field('accN', 'U4'), |
229 | 225 | core.Field('accE', 'U4'), |
230 | 226 | core.Field('accD', 'U4'), |
231 | | - core.Field('accLength', 'U4'), |
232 | | - core.Field('accHeading', 'U4'), |
233 | | - core.PadByte(repeat=3), |
234 | 227 | core.BitField('flags', 'X4', [ |
235 | 228 | core.Flag('gnssFixOK', 0, 1), |
236 | 229 | core.Flag('diffSoln', 1, 2), |
|
0 commit comments